340. One day(2/2)

Both girls laughed heartily.

Ha La attended every class seriously, listened to every word the teacher said without distraction, took notes on every page, and worked hard with her classmates to prepare for the exam.

After class, Hala found Kate and chatted happily. They talked about Wharton's life, the news in the newspaper, and enjoyed the future together.

After school, the two made an appointment to walk to school together tomorrow. When they parted, Ha La still felt that everything was like a dream.

After she returned home, she found that Hewen was still sitting in the study idly reading. Ha La walked to the door of the study cautiously:

"I made a friend today."

Hewen smiled:

"Oh, how are your new friends? Is school going well?"

Ha La trotted out, poured a glass of juice for Hevin and herself, and excitedly shared her day's life.

Hevin listened to Ha La's words very carefully and occasionally asked Ha La two questions. The two of them laughed together from time to time.

Until the sun sets and the sky becomes dark.

Ha La dragged her tired body back to the room and lay on the bed.

She recalled the whole day today. She could remember what everyone said and when. Her life was very real and every second was meaningful.
